Research Experience
  • Machine Learning Research Fellow for Medical Imaging at BHF Centre for Cardiovascular Science, University of Edinburgh, UK.
Background
  • Research Interests: Machine Learning in Medicine, Data Analysis, Computational Healthcare, Internet of Things. Focuses on the application of cutting-edge machine learning technology to medical data analysis and clinical decision-making, including object detection, segmentation, and quantification in medical images, as well as multimodal (e.g., image, genetic, and molecular data) fusion, simulation, cross-domain synthesis, lifelong learning for automatic diagnosis and treatment planning with imperfect data. Recently, his research has focused on the interpretability and generalizability of deep learning models.
